The Illusion of Manual Control

When your operators are carrying out highly repetitive and manual tasks, expecting them to meticulously record performance data is a recipe for disaster. Relying on paper trails, manual spreadsheets, or visual checks gives a false sense of security. Manual feedback is inherently retrospective; by the time an error is logged, reported, and analysed by your quality control team, a whole batch of defective products might have already moved down the line.

Manual systems are slow and highly prone to human error and bias, meaning issues are identified long after they occur. In contrast, automated systems catch faults immediately, which saves both time and money.

Traceability

The feedback you actually need to improve your bottom line is granular. Traceability is a powerful tool in the manufacturing process, and through the use of barcodes, 2D data matrices, and RFID tags, a company has access to a wide variety of data.

With an automated system, you instantly gain access to vital metrics:

  • The exact who, what, where, and when of the manufacturing process.
  • Highly detailed assembly and test data.
  • Precise component origin tracking and cycle times.

By integrating a comprehensive Statistical Process Control (SPC) data collection package directly with the machine, we ensure precise monitoring and control of production processes. This technology allows robust traceability systems to be developed, offering potential cost savings in areas such as warranty claims, product recalls, and overall efficiency. You can maintain accurate and detailed records, facilitating rigorous quality control and compliance with industry standards.
